WebGreek mythology describes various great floods throughout ancient history. Differing sources refer to the flood of Ogyges, the flood of Deucalion, and the flood of Dardanus, though often with similar or even contradictory details.Like most flood myths, these stories often involve themes of divine retribution, the savior of a culture hero, and the birth of a … WebAug 27, 1996 · This guide goes beyond a cursory glance at Greek Mythology to look at the mythological gods, heroes, origin tales, and cultural significance for those who are new adult (18-21) and Adults. ... WebJul 15, 2024 · Pegasus: The Winged Horse of Greek Mythology By Mike Greenberg, PhD May 23, 2024 Greek Medusa: The Monster Who Turned Men to Stone By Mike … WebSep 1, 2013 · In Greek mythology, the Minotaur was a monster with the body of a man and the head and tail of a bull. The Minotaur was the offspring of the Cretan Queen Pasiphae and a majestic bull. Due to the Minotaur's monstrous form, King Minos ordered the craftsman, Daedalus, and his son, Icarus, to build a huge maze known as the …

WebDec 9, 2024 · Pandora was the first human woman in Greek mythology, created by the gods for the express purpose of punishing mortals. The gods entrusted Pandora with a … WebMar 12, 2024 · Perseus, the mortal son of Zeus and the Argive princess Danae, was a Greek hero, king, and slayer of monsters. After he and his mother were exiled from their homeland, Perseus was raised on a remote island where he grew up protecting his mother from the cruel King Polydectes. Perseus made his name by killing Medusa, a monster …
